Whether David Eastwood can restore the Higher Education Funding Council's role as a buffer between the Government and the universities remains to be seen. What matters really is that he should effectively represent the sector's interests in his dealings with politicians and the wider world.
There is little question that Eastwood is capable of this. He is smart, realistic, has strong views and is utterly steely beneath the hail-fellow-well-met exterior, according to those who know him. He should therefore be a match for any minister and for those mandarins at the Treasury.
